Transaction 39d20d5ae79768768b5af3ed772b5e6a54869524e5d7ddf93bf0f04efca21be2

1 Input
2 Outputs
  • 39d20d5ae79768768b5af3ed772b5e6a54869524e5d7ddf93bf0f04efca21be2:0
  • value  1923998
    address  3ACyT6nsQhxb9YgChrznCJfwvoRPhyK1rK
  • 39d20d5ae79768768b5af3ed772b5e6a54869524e5d7ddf93bf0f04efca21be2:1
  • value  20926172
    address  34X34wFMFWxhVbYdwpccnXQLUwLd2cRMom